# Code flow ---------------------------------------------------------------
#' Authorization
#'
#' Authorize your R session to connect to an ArcGIS Portal. See details.
#'
#' @details
#'
#' ArcGIS Online and Enterprise Portals utilize OAuth2 authorization via their REST APIs.
#'
#' - `auth_code()` is the recommend OAuth2 workflow for interactive sessions
#' - `auth_client()` is the recommended OAuth2 workflow for non-interactive sessions
#' - `auth_user()` uses legacy username and password authorization using the `generateToken` endpoint. It is only recommended for legacy systems that do not implement OAuth2.
#' - `auth_binding()` fetches a token from the active portal set by `arcgisbinding`. Uses `arcgisbinding::arc.check_portal()` to extract the authorization token. Recommended if using arcgisbinding.
#'
#' @param client an OAuth 2.0 developer application client ID. By default uses the
#' environment variable `ARCGIS_CLIENT`.
#' @param secret an OAuth 2.0 developer application secret. By default uses the environment
#' variable `ARCGIS_SECRET`.
#' @param host default `"https://www.arcgis.com"`
#' @param expiration the duration of the token in minutes.
#'
#' @rdname auth
#' @export
#' @examples
#'
#' \dontrun{
#' auth_code()
#' auth_client()
#' auth_user()
#' auth_binding()
#' }
#' @returns an `httr2_token`
